On November 1, 2025, I had mine and my husband’s 50th wedding anniversary party at The Lighthouse. I started planning it a year ago, when we had our 49th anniversary dinner there (one of many over the years). I signed the contract and started the planning with Lauren. Unbeknownst to me at the time, after planning with Lauren, the restaurant had changed management and I resumed planning the Sarah O’Reilly. Sarah was helpful and kind, had wonderful suggestions and listened and responded to every call and email.
I had originally booked the smaller banquet room thinking my guest count would be less than 60, when it went to 75 (64 was the finally yes count), she said that even at 60, the smaller room might be tight but that the bigger room was available and she moved me to that room. My husband and I met with Sarah in the venue and went over table placement, cake placement options and finalized my menu choices. Working with Sarah was a wonderful experience, and I will miss it!
The meals were perfectly cooked and presented with all my guests raving at them. We had the 8oz filet, the chicken piccata and the macadamia crusted walleye. We also had 8 children’s meals and those were also delicious. We also had one gluten free meal and it was also perfect.
The wait staff and bartender were attentive, friendly and always had a smile on their faces. Renee, the head server was there meeting all of our needs, sometimes even before I knew I needed them!

The bottom line is that our 50th wedding anniversary was a triumph. I can’t thank The Lighthouse Restaurant, Sarah, Renee and her staff and the bartender enough. I apologize for not getting all the names, especially the bartender because she was wonderful. Well done.

We haven't been to the Lighthouse Restaurant in years. After looking at the menu online, we decided to go. Upon arriving, we found out it is under new management. No worries! We had an amazing waitress named Karen, who went above and beyond to see that we had a wonderful meal! I noticed the menu was different than the one we read online. I was disappointed that Chicken Marsala was not on the menu in front of me. I told Karen, and she said that although it was no longer on the menu, she wanted to talk to the chef to see what he could do. Not only did he agree to prepare it, he gave Karen a sample of the sauce he was going to use to see if I liked it. It was delicious! Not only did we all thoroughly enjoy our meals, my husband said that his prime rib was likely the best he's ever had! What a delightful evening! If you go, I highly recommend Karen!
